Best Fonts for Websites

Discover the best fonts for websites in 2025! Learn about top font choices, pairing tips, and how to enhance your site's design, readability, and brand identity.

Typography is far more than just picking a pretty font for your website. It’s the backbone of how your message is communicated, shaping everything from readability to how visitors perceive your brand. A well-chosen font can set the tone of your website, guiding users through content seamlessly, while a poor choice can leave them frustrated and bouncing off your site.

Imagine reading a blog with hard-to-read fonts or an eCommerce site where the product descriptions are in tiny, cramped text. Not the best experience, right? That’s why choosing the best fonts for your website isn’t just about aesthetics—it’s about enhancing user experience and aligning with your brand identity.

In this guide, we’ll dive into font categories, share expert recommendations, and give you the tools to select the perfect fonts that enhance your website’s design and functionality. Ready to make your website stand out with the right typography? Let’s get started!

Understanding the Key Font Categories for Web Design

Before you start picking fonts, it's important to understand the different categories they fall into. Each type of font serves a specific purpose, whether it’s creating a professional vibe, evoking creativity, or ensuring readability. Getting familiar with these categories will help you make more informed decisions when selecting the perfect font for your website.

Serif Fonts: Adding Elegance and Authority to Your Site

Serif fonts are the classic choice for websites that need to convey reliability and professionalism. These fonts feature the little “feet” at the ends of the letters, which give them a more formal and traditional look. Think of them as fonts with a bit of sophistication—perfect for businesses in industries like law, finance, and academia.

For example, Times New Roman and Georgia are widely used in news articles, educational websites, and even some high-end brands. They make text appear more serious and can help your content feel grounded and trustworthy. If you’re looking for elegance with a touch of formality, serif fonts are your best bet.

Sans-Serif Fonts: The Modern and Minimalist Choice

On the flip side, sans-serif fonts are sleek, modern, and perfect for websites looking to give off a clean and minimalistic vibe. These fonts don't have the little feet at the end of the letters, which makes them appear more contemporary and easier to read, especially on screens. If your brand is all about simplicity and efficiency, sans-serif fonts will resonate well.

Fonts like Helvetica, Arial, and Roboto are easy to read and are commonly found on tech websites, startups, and eCommerce platforms. Their simplicity ensures that your content is easy to digest, and they work great across devices, from desktop to mobile. If your website aims for a fresh, modern look, sans-serif fonts are a great choice.

Script Fonts: Infusing Creativity and Personality

If you want to add a little flair to your website, script fonts might be the way to go. These fonts mimic handwritten text, bringing in an elegant, creative, or even playful vibe. They’re perfect for personal blogs, wedding sites, or creative portfolios where personality and uniqueness matter.

Think of fonts like Pacifico or Lobster—they’re fun, bold, and eye-catching. But, be cautious! These fonts should be used sparingly, ideally in headers or special highlights, to ensure they don’t overpower the design or hurt readability. Script fonts add character, but they work best when paired thoughtfully with more readable fonts.

Top 10 Best Fonts for Websites in 2025: Our Expert Picks

Now that you understand the different font categories, let’s dive into the best fonts for your website in 2025. These fonts have been handpicked for their versatility, readability, and overall design quality. Whether you’re building a corporate site, a personal blog, or an online store, these fonts are guaranteed to elevate your web design.

1. Roboto: The Versatile Sans-Serif for Any Website

Roboto is one of the most popular and widely used web fonts for good reason. Its clean and modern design makes it perfect for almost any website. It’s highly legible across devices, from desktop screens to mobile phones, making it a top choice for web designers looking for versatility.

It’s neutral enough to work with any type of content, from blogs to eCommerce sites, but still has enough personality to make it stand out. Roboto is also available in multiple weights, giving you flexibility in design—whether you need it for body text or bold headlines.

2. Inter: A Font Designed for High Legibility on Screens

Inter is a sleek, sans-serif font created with the goal of maximizing readability on screens. It’s perfect for UI elements and user interfaces, as it’s clear and easy to read even at small sizes. Many tech companies and startups use Inter to give their sites a modern, clean look without sacrificing readability.

This font comes in a variety of weights and features a slightly condensed design, which allows for better legibility in small spaces. If you’re building a website with a lot of content or complex layouts, Inter ensures that text remains readable and user-friendly.

3. Poppins: Modern, Geometric, and Perfect for Clean Websites

Poppins is a geometric sans-serif font that brings a bold yet friendly touch to your website. Its rounded letters give it a soft, approachable feel, while its geometric shapes give it a modern and structured appearance. This font is a great choice for tech, fashion, and creative websites looking for a polished yet inviting look.

With multiple weights and an extensive character set, Poppins is highly versatile and works well for both headers and body text. It’s especially effective for making a statement without being overwhelming.

4. Raleway: Elegant and Sophisticated for High-End Websites

Raleway is an elegant, sans-serif font that’s perfect for websites with a touch of sophistication. Its clean lines and distinctive letterforms make it ideal for headings, titles, and logos. Raleway is often used in upscale brands, luxury product pages, and high-end service websites.

Though it’s perfect for larger text, it can also be paired with other fonts for a balanced, readable look. Whether you're showcasing a boutique or a corporate site, Raleway adds a modern yet refined touch.

5. Satoshi: A Stylish Blend of Tradition and Modernity

Satoshi is a modern typeface that blends traditional elements with contemporary design. Its versatility makes it suitable for a wide range of websites, from blogs to business sites. The rounded letterforms give it a friendly, approachable feel, while the angular strokes add a bit of sharpness and personality.

Satoshi works especially well in creative industries or personal websites, where you want your text to feel both approachable and professional. Its modern look also makes it a great option for startups or tech companies that want to present themselves as both innovative and grounded.

6. Neue Montreal: Sleek and Contemporary for Innovative Brands

Neue Montreal is a sleek and contemporary font that’s perfect for websites wanting to convey innovation and modernity. With its sharp lines and minimalist design, it’s ideal for creative agencies, tech startups, and any brand that values clean, high-impact typography.

This font works well across various screen sizes, from large desktop monitors to small mobile screens, ensuring consistency and readability no matter the device. It’s perfect for websites looking to create a cutting-edge, stylish appearance.

7. Helvetica Now: A Refined Take on the Iconic Helvetica

Helvetica is a classic font, but Helvetica Now brings it into the modern age. This refined version of the iconic typeface offers improved legibility and more flexibility for web design. It’s ideal for websites that want to maintain a clean and timeless look while improving readability.

Its neutral, no-frills design works well across any industry, from fashion to corporate. If you're aiming for simplicity without sacrificing style, Helvetica Now offers a perfect balance of modernity and classic appeal.

8. Neue Haas Grotesk: A Timeless Choice for Simple Websites

Neue Haas Grotesk is the original version of Helvetica, offering a more neutral and balanced look that can work well for modern websites. It’s a versatile font that can be used across multiple types of sites, from personal blogs to corporate pages. Its simple design makes it great for large blocks of text while still maintaining a sleek look in headers and logos.

If you want a timeless, no-nonsense font that never goes out of style, Neue Haas Grotesk is a solid option. It’s great for websites looking for a minimalist yet professional aesthetic.

9. Aeonik: Elegant and Readable for Professional Websites

Aeonik is a clean, geometric sans-serif font that balances modernity with readability. Its elegant design makes it perfect for business websites, portfolios, and online stores. Whether you’re highlighting key content or showcasing a product, Aeonik’s neutral and stylish design works well.

It’s available in a variety of weights, which allows for flexibility in your website's layout. Whether you're designing a simple landing page or a more complex site, Aeonik’s readability ensures that your visitors stay engaged.

10. Libre Franklin: A Humanist Font for Classic Websites

Libre Franklin is a humanist sans-serif font that’s perfect for websites wanting to keep things professional yet approachable. It has a more organic feel compared to more rigid geometric fonts, giving it a warm, inviting appearance. It works particularly well for educational sites, blogs, and any website looking for a classic, easy-to-read font.

With its broad character set and multiple weights, Libre Franklin is highly versatile and ensures that text looks balanced and readable across all types of content.

Font Pairing: How to Combine Fonts for Web Design

Font pairing is an art that can make or break your website's design. The right combination can elevate your typography, create a visually appealing layout, and improve user experience. But pairing fonts isn't just about picking two fonts that look good together. It's about balancing contrast, establishing hierarchy, and ensuring readability.

Why Font Pairing Matters for Website Design

When done correctly, font pairing helps guide the user’s eye across the page and directs attention to important elements like headings and calls to action. Using different fonts for headers and body text creates visual contrast, which makes your content more engaging and easier to read.

Effective font pairing enhances the overall design of your site by balancing personality and readability. It allows your fonts to work together harmoniously, ensuring the content flows smoothly and doesn’t overwhelm your visitors.

Best Font Pairing Practices for Web Design

Here are a few tried-and-true practices to keep in mind when pairing fonts for your website:

  • Pair Serif with Sans-Serif: One of the most effective ways to create contrast is by pairing serif fonts for headings with sans-serif fonts for body text, or vice versa. For example, Roboto (sans-serif) paired with Merriweather (serif) creates a balanced, readable combination.
  • Mix Different Weights and Styles: Use different font weights (light, bold, etc.) and styles (italic, regular) to establish hierarchy and direct the reader’s attention. A great example is pairing Helvetica Neue in bold for headings with Helvetica Neue Light for body text.
  • Stick to Two or Three Fonts: While it might be tempting to experiment with multiple fonts, sticking to two or three can help maintain a cohesive design. Too many font styles can make your website look cluttered and confusing.

Examples of Effective Font Pairing

To give you some inspiration, here are a few font pairings that work well together:

  1. Montserrat (heading) + Open Sans (body)
  2. Playfair Display (heading) + Source Sans Pro (body)
  3. Raleway (heading) + Roboto (body)
  4. Lora (heading) + Quicksand (body)

These combinations offer a nice contrast without competing for attention, allowing for easy readability and a cohesive design.

How to Align Fonts with Your Brand Identity

Typography is a powerful tool that can convey your brand’s personality before your users even read a single word of content. The fonts you choose should reflect your brand's voice, values, and overall aesthetic. Whether you're a tech startup, a luxury brand, or a personal blog, the right font choices can strengthen your brand identity and create a more memorable user experience.

Understanding Brand Personality Through Typography

Every brand has a personality. Some are bold, modern, and innovative, while others are traditional, reliable, and sophisticated. Fonts are an essential part of how a brand's personality is communicated. For example, if you're building a site for a financial institution, you’ll want to choose fonts that convey professionalism, stability, and trustworthiness, like Georgia or Merriweather. On the other hand, if you're running a creative agency or personal portfolio, you might go for something more playful and dynamic, like Poppins or Raleway.

Your font choices should help reinforce these values and support the message you want to convey. The right typography can instantly communicate what your brand stands for without saying a word.

Choosing Fonts That Match Your Brand’s Message

Now that you have an understanding of brand personality, it’s time to choose fonts that match your brand’s message. Here are a few tips for aligning your fonts with your brand:

  • For Formal and Corporate Brands: Use serif fonts for a traditional and established feel. Think about Times New Roman or Roboto Slab for an authoritative presence.
  • For Creative and Innovative Brands: Sans-serif fonts or geometric fonts are ideal for startups, tech companies, or any business aiming for a modern, clean, and approachable vibe. Consider fonts like Helvetica, Inter, or Satoshi.
  • For Playful and Personal Brands: Script fonts like Pacifico or Lobster can infuse creativity and personality. However, use them sparingly to avoid overwhelming your content.

By choosing fonts that reflect your brand’s values, you’re ensuring that your website resonates with your target audience from the moment they land on your page.

Real-Life Examples: How Top Brands Use Typography to Strengthen Their Identity

Let’s look at some successful companies and how they’ve leveraged typography to communicate their brand identity:

  • Apple: Known for its clean and minimalist design, Apple uses San Francisco, a custom sans-serif font, that speaks to its modern, user-friendly, and cutting-edge brand.
  • The New York Times: A trusted name in news, The New York Times uses Georgia for its main body text, conveying reliability and seriousness.
  • Spotify: Spotify uses Proxima Nova, a modern sans-serif font, to project a trendy, youthful, and tech-forward identity, perfectly aligned with its music-streaming platform.

These brands are great examples of how choosing the right font helps communicate a brand's essence and connect with its audience.

Conclusion: How to Choose the Best Fonts for Your Website in 2025

Choosing the best fonts for your website isn’t just about looking good—it’s about making your content readable, engaging, and aligned with your brand. By understanding font categories, pairing fonts thoughtfully, and ensuring brand consistency, you can elevate the user experience and strengthen your brand identity. Typography has the power to guide visitors, enhance design, and even impact your site’s performance.

Take the time to explore different fonts and experiment with pairings that suit your website's goals. With the right font choices, your site will not only look more professional but also connect with your audience on a deeper level. Start today and watch your website’s design transform!

FAQs About Choosing the Best Fonts for Your Website

What are the best fonts for a website?

The best fonts for a website are those that enhance readability and align with your brand's identity. Popular choices include Roboto, Open Sans, Lato, Montserrat, and Playfair Display. These fonts are widely used due to their clean design and versatility across various devices and screen sizes.

How do I choose the right font for my website?

To choose the right font, consider your brand's personality, the type of content, and your target audience. For example, serif fonts like Georgia convey tradition and reliability, making them suitable for law firms or academic institutions. Sans-serif fonts like Helvetica or Roboto offer a modern and clean look, ideal for tech companies or startups. Always prioritize readability and ensure the font complements your website's design.

Should I use one or multiple fonts on my website?

Using two to three fonts is generally recommended for web design. A common practice is to pair a serif font for headings with a sans-serif font for body text. This combination creates a visual hierarchy and enhances readability. For instance, pairing Playfair Display (serif) with Roboto (sans-serif) can provide a balanced and aesthetically pleasing design.

Are Google Fonts free to use on my website?

Yes, Google Fonts offers a vast collection of free, open-source fonts that can be easily integrated into your website. These fonts are optimized for web use and are widely supported across different browsers and devices. You can browse and select fonts from the Google Fonts library.

How can I ensure my website's fonts are accessible?

To ensure accessibility, choose fonts that are legible and support a wide range of characters. Avoid using decorative or overly stylized fonts for body text. Fonts like Arial, Verdana, and Open Sans are known for their readability. Additionally, ensure sufficient contrast between text and background, and consider users with dyslexia or visual impairments by selecting fonts designed for accessibility.

Kinnari Ashar

Kinnari Ashar is a published author, editor, and seasoned content strategist with over a decade of experience crafting SEO-driven content across the beauty, lifestyle, and tech industries. With a background in biomedical engineering, Kinnari combines technical insight with creative writing, delivering engaging and well-researched content. In addition to her work for Spocket, her writing has been featured on platforms like BeBeautiful.in, and she excels in developing content strategies that resonate with diverse audiences.

Recommended Articles

Marketing
minutes read
Is Vistaprint a Safe Website
Ashutosh Ranjan
June 6, 2025
10 min read
Logo Evolution
minutes read
Car with Cat Logo
Ashutosh Ranjan
June 5, 2025
10 min read
Logo Evolution
minutes read
Linux Logo
Ashutosh Ranjan
June 4, 2025
10 min read

Ready to generate your logo and brand kit with AI?

Discover how 500,000+ businesses and creators are using our AI logo maker in their Logo creation.

check icon
no credit card or upfront payment required.
Gradient
Gradient Circle
Gradient Circle
Gradient Circle